Anyone know where I can get a two-step for my stick car? I keep hearing great things about the Harlan two-step but I think the only way you can get those now is used.
I know EFILive has a two-step function built into the COS but it's a fuel cut instead of a spark cut and won't allow me to build boost. The RPM limiter is the icing, building a small amount of boost at the line is the cake for me.
